Rearing Hideousness
a short poem
(I wrote this because poetry is the most effective means of self-expression, and it's how I process the thoughts and emotions going on in my head. In retrospect, though, I also wrote it for anyone that might be going through the same or similar thing, and to remind us that there is always hope and free will. We can't let the darkness win. Always choose to prevail.)
**
What do you do
when the streets feel cold,
when the world turns gray?
When the most energy
you have is expelled on
the frivolous, instead of
necessary things, vital to your being,
to your creativity
and individuality?
Do you lie in bed, succumbing
to this malaise and
pressing darkness?
Or do you inexplicably fight to overcome it?
